The International Cricket Council (ICC) published the official anthem for the 2023 World Cup on Wednesday.
Official anthem World Cup Dil Jashn Bole: The anthem, titled “Dil Jashn Bole,” tries to encapsulate the passion and spirit of one of the most anticipated sporting events.
Ranveer Singh, a well-known Indian actor, makes a star-studded appearance in the song, adding to the frenzy.
Singh and renowned Bollywood composer Pritam collaborated on the anthem.

Furthermore, From October 5 to November 19, 10 sites will host the ICC World Cup 2023, which will feature 10 nations competing for the coveted trophy. However, The tournament’s opening match and the championship game will both be played at Ahmedabad’s Narendra Modi Stadium.
All teams will compete against one another for a total of 45 league matches during the round-robin style Cricket World Cup.
However, The top four teams will advance to the semifinals, which will take place on November 15 in Mumbai and on November 16 in Kolkata. Further, There will be reserve days for the semifinals and championship.
